2841 Commits

Author SHA1 Message Date
Jaifroid
03a792a146 Merge branch 'master' of https://github.com/kiwix/kiwix-js-windows
Former-commit-id: 5b5c4343165cce14b16c6682e93dcd27e214ce23
2022-11-26 12:46:54 +00:00
Jaifroid
0e8da7606a Add fulltext directory listing to archive metadata
Import from upstream for testing https://github.com/kiwix/kiwix-js/pull/932


Former-commit-id: 004613b1e882bab708af1a46c9ef6306f7e2fcd4
2022-11-26 12:43:11 +00:00
Jaifroid
f763c61a76 Update README.md
Change image order

Former-commit-id: 8d9d852fe8e7fe92e6f396bc8a24f444d69e4160
2022-11-26 06:58:39 +00:00
Jaifroid
5f863ef591 Remove unused functions
Former-commit-id: 2c5bfa51c48503cf2764a30384205a20805a36f8
2022-11-22 21:07:05 +00:00
Jaifroid
2c8854ef15 Remove jQuery for various functions (click, attr, focus)
Part of #313


Former-commit-id: 066f6e2449158ac361c5b96e1f32ef27fc708a13
2022-11-22 20:54:54 +00:00
Jaifroid
feb8baf95e Update Electron to 18.3.15 and latest eletron-builder
Former-commit-id: 9e06baf38a79b2d1539eea984ef70dd88aeef1a1
2022-11-22 07:11:07 +00:00
Jaifroid
80849baed2 Update front page image (#317)
Former-commit-id: 50dcce8c78440e67eb7e9098cdbab42e01d0ceb0
2022-11-21 22:36:08 +00:00
Jaifroid
fe02140845 Update Kiwix_JS_Windows_Release_Body.md
Former-commit-id: 956a6970d511fcbb7da1519708fa6deacc82b54e
2022-11-20 20:36:12 +00:00
Jaifroid
7bd498f80e Add infor about DarkReader
Former-commit-id: a25042381501e474f0dd7445a1defd7d6245ed63
2022-11-20 20:29:12 +00:00
Jaifroid
4687cec2a8 Update style-dark.css
Former-commit-id: 14dd86995700e1329ccee1c3ec4f1467e0c8fb7a
2022-11-20 15:20:19 +00:00
Jaifroid
c483f64f52 Update winget manifests
Former-commit-id: 0f06eab7cdab2ce9969bd3b1afdd059cffa6a0dc
2022-11-20 15:10:52 +00:00
Jaifroid
3c6bfd80ac UWP app packages for v2.2.5
Former-commit-id: 06a010cce2e9249e09f0c9db087b0e4638ee07ee
v2.2.5-E
2022-11-20 14:22:34 +00:00
Jaifroid
04c555bc00 Update permalinks
Former-commit-id: 0be6dedaeb971fc90c0951a9b2869f928fff50a1
2022-11-20 14:21:26 +00:00
Jaifroid
5177feb31d One more changelog item
Former-commit-id: ac87885353ec92f9a96efc3f0d5831d6f3921bd9
v2.2.5
2022-11-20 11:07:18 +00:00
Jaifroid
820deb1691 Add missing BOM required for certification
Former-commit-id: 188e1e52f087edc168e3c0b8128fcd9457d03925
2022-11-20 10:58:40 +00:00
Jaifroid
b2e2b01191 UWP app packages
Former-commit-id: ccbc13a436dd02f8f1c3e502739a46a2e4f1c66f
2022-11-20 10:58:19 +00:00
Jaifroid
9e67bec208 Bump app version to 2.2.5
Former-commit-id: b266262f387161e3c0a6e619fd38cc40468d68de
2022-11-20 10:07:24 +00:00
Jaifroid
cf6e89655e Ensure only UWP app auto-switches to standard dark theme
Former-commit-id: 090163bd7dd75406c00c58f60acb221e4fc02ebb
2022-11-20 10:05:56 +00:00
Jaifroid
08256779fd Fix font colour issue in UWP app with standard dark theme
Former-commit-id: b329dcb5e5c2d0afb069a869cbe687c6137b7674
2022-11-20 10:05:14 +00:00
Jaifroid
25b720adee Update changelogs
Former-commit-id: 7fb013789c52638e6c8877e2d866eaef4cfca027
2022-11-20 09:07:55 +00:00
Jaifroid
dba9af1e87 Only turn of DarkReader automatically if we are in UWP app
Former-commit-id: b51a705148d566de3437cd54dd47982d4bfb4c55
2022-11-20 08:56:09 +00:00
Jaifroid
edd3381356 Ensure params are correctly passed between modes
Former-commit-id: 42b5d749e50a65d20cc6fc7eac791bc4c98a4722
2022-11-20 08:55:45 +00:00
Jaifroid
9970a41f26 Prevent UWP app crash when switching between modes
Former-commit-id: aab5582345e8115970cb0db8f8206191f4b14b1d
2022-11-19 18:30:10 +00:00
Jaifroid
08d38119cc Add odt download support
Fixes #312


Former-commit-id: 6b1cc9f15dbc7850354818fb1eb0bbdf8089d72f
2022-11-19 18:01:39 +00:00
Jaifroid
a8796a85dd Fixes for dark theme infobox headers
Former-commit-id: c8e476cfc60127c1277fce2f6f00ed422c4b6ddf
2022-11-19 16:09:29 +00:00
Jaifroid
c2692e9655 Do not hide activeContentWarning as soon as it is displayed
Fixes #315


Former-commit-id: 2f0c5b3dde88dda68c03331749198751fc217880
2022-11-17 21:23:41 +00:00
Jaifroid
f8854fdf04 Ensure darkReader can't be accidentally turned on in jQuery mode
Former-commit-id: aeaf06ee365472995410572eddc3ab6c9631545b
2022-11-16 14:35:03 +00:00
Jaifroid
924ce6ba52 Bump changelogs
Former-commit-id: bf010ab460a267b449ad5dac0063a013d608f090
2022-11-16 14:25:42 +00:00
Jaifroid
ffd8330c25 More dark theme updates
Former-commit-id: 380e54e5246b0a4bf11ed2ea31334eee7644d311
2022-11-16 14:20:52 +00:00
Jaifroid
950f0d75fa Update dark theme style fix
Former-commit-id: 39f59bb17a3e69d4d17116c6d15de9c1e64c1524
2022-11-16 08:04:21 +00:00
Jaifroid
59eab65132 Invert equation images in dark mode
Former-commit-id: d114555755dfc9f7039e7409d8dc7764301ae174
2022-11-16 07:16:48 +00:00
Jaifroid
8e0e12f051 Test for more conditional DOM elements
Former-commit-id: b9bec0298f85cf8001a6e3bc8d330baf2c115434
2022-11-16 07:14:17 +00:00
Jaifroid
f9f409a9a0 Remove jQuery hide/show statements (#314)
Former-commit-id: 48a9f7f4a1623476a52b01d977dc7e7648f6cb08
2022-11-16 06:59:33 +00:00
Jaifroid
4548b9f2de Update packaged ZIM description
Former-commit-id: abe7e60327f5eed7592559e49bd9e60b05ba02c5
2022-11-15 06:12:56 +00:00
Jaifroid
b949bd3894 Update UWP manifests
Former-commit-id: 157b55e4bf5cf862bfd3dc145d27ff1285b0261f
2022-11-13 21:02:36 +00:00
Jaifroid
97348dbd23 Bump app version
Former-commit-id: 23403ccd251502d46285619ba3b10fbec8c9fd45
2022-11-13 20:53:38 +00:00
Jaifroid
5863578bde Remove references to climate change ZIM
Former-commit-id: 0e6ea07999f3c378acdd7913785ec84b879d5061
2022-11-13 20:52:30 +00:00
Jaifroid
4114af4ba0 Update changelogs
Former-commit-id: 82feb0844ef248af9d406dfa80995e199346f32c
2022-11-13 20:47:03 +00:00
Jaifroid
11f546b0ce Update archive to wikipedia_en_100_mini_2022-10
Former-commit-id: 5fa88f3b0958f9676862f3e249cc466e56da8a27
2022-11-13 20:40:34 +00:00
Jaifroid
491ecb57b7 Add dark reader to list of PWA files
Former-commit-id: a5242854bcd27e5f2b6a898a7c326595805ee3ce
2022-11-13 18:29:30 +00:00
Jaifroid
fdef6f1f20 Create style-dark-darkreader-static.css
Former-commit-id: 15aedc3d6b4b45fda30e809f4b19c14323b1808a
2022-11-13 17:21:59 +00:00
Jaifroid
3d275f634d Remove redundant !important in style-mobile
Former-commit-id: 932f54864747cae43dcf125cc29968603c722edb
2022-11-13 11:52:39 +00:00
Jaifroid
f32404fe5d Update style-mobile.css
Former-commit-id: 0727d4e49f0a17d102fb9a2508bba9325ad0b00e
2022-11-13 11:16:42 +00:00
Jaifroid
a31cb91e70 Do not switch to darkReader mode if appType is UWP
Former-commit-id: 5adc7c4486f96d3381b499662a72921e372f541e
2022-11-13 10:32:49 +00:00
Jaifroid
af13c1acb0 Add DarkReader fetch method
Former-commit-id: b5a5fabf5914cc10b98c269d69ee375606d76e9b
2022-11-11 15:32:18 +00:00
Jaifroid
cf5cf5fb26 Same
Former-commit-id: 9ada84ef939609ca0db953a19b543d93c47084ff
2022-11-09 15:22:05 +00:00
Jaifroid
244ae1d622 Auto switch off darkReader if WikiMedia ZIM is loaded
Former-commit-id: 48765e9c251a3b0969fc34b7fa6d7d506405295f
2022-11-09 15:17:11 +00:00
Jaifroid
7921c31af6 Recognize eot files as assets
Former-commit-id: c7954def90a47e7217150a2657ecd4a4c0624566
2022-11-09 07:06:44 +00:00
Jaifroid
edb513c5e5 Ensure UI is properly set with dark theme options
Former-commit-id: c7fc75a1e92305069c1c0dd43996918c2f8ea89b
2022-11-08 20:20:30 +00:00
Jaifroid
a84b32ddfa Clean up loading of DarkReader
Former-commit-id: 9e7a833be3c8512c21b18ec6b2f3f2ad8826010a
2022-11-06 17:55:51 +00:00